Ananda College Athletes to Represent Sri Lanka at the World Junior Athletics Championship 2024

July 1, 2024

Ananda College is proud to announce that three of our outstanding athletes have qualified to represent Sri Lanka at the World Junior Athletics Championship 2024, which will be held in Peru. This remarkable achievement reflects their dedication, hard work, and the exceptional training and support provided by our college sports facilities.

The athletes who have earned this prestigious honor are:

Meron Wijesinghe – Competing in the 100m event.
Indusara Widushan – Competing in the 200m event.
Lesandu Arthawidu – Competing in the high jump event.

These talented young athletes have not only qualified for the world stage but have also showcased their prowess at the National Athletics Championship. Each of them secured second place in their respective events, demonstrating their competitiveness and skills against the nations best.

Meron Wijesinghe sprinted his way to the silver medal in the 100m event. His explosive speed and unwavering determination have made him a standout athlete, and we are confident that he will make us proud on the global stage.
Indusara Widushan displayed incredible speed and endurance to secure second place in the 200m event. His commitment to excellence and relentless training regimen have paid off, earning him a well-deserved spot on the national team. His achievement is a new junior national record.

Lesandu Arthawidu soared to new heights in the high jump, claiming the silver medal at the National Athletics Championship. His remarkable technique and athleticism have distinguished him as one of the top young high jumpers in the country.
